Common DoorKing Gate Repair Problems We Solve in Agoura
- Hinge pin shear on oversized equestrian gates. Old Agoura’s horse properties legally require 14–16 foot driveway gates for trailer clearance, but many owners retrofit standard DoorKing 6200 swing operators onto these massive frames. The pintle hinges and manual-release brackets weren’t specced for that load. We see the bolts shear within two or three seasons, and by then the operator’s limit switches are already drifting. We replace with forged 3/4-inch steel pins and recalibrate from the footing up.
- Control board corrosion in 1837 keypads. Santa Ana winds don’t just rattle your gate — they drive fine dust and moisture deep into unsealed keypad housings. On ridge-facing lots above Kanan Road, we’ve pulled DoorKing 1837 entry systems with board corrosion that looks like coastal damage even though the ocean’s fifteen miles away. We reseal housings and replace with weather-rated components where the original design falls short.
- Gearbox wear in 6300 slide operators from sustained wind load. When gusts hit 25+ mph through the Santa Monica Mountain passes, slide gates fight their operators constantly. The 6300’s gearbox takes that abuse every cycle, and we see premature wear here at roughly three times the rate we do in Calabasas. Catching it early means a gear assembly replacement instead of a full operator.
- Travel limit drift from post-footing heave. Post-Woolsey rebuilds in Agoura used fresh concrete that hadn’t finished settling. Come winter rains, expansive clay soil pushes those footings around, and suddenly your DoorKing 6200 thinks the gate path is two inches shorter than reality. We relevel, repour where needed, and recalibrate limits to actual gate position — not where the concrete used to be.
- Fire-code retrofit complications on post-Woolsey gates. Every gate replacement after 2018 in Agoura’s VHFHSZ zone needs non-combustible hardware and Knox-compatible access. We’ve seen DoorKing operators installed by out-of-area contractors who missed the key switch requirement entirely, leaving homeowners with a functional gate that fails LA County inspection. We fix that.
DoorKing Service in Agoura: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ment
The 2018 Woolsey Fire burned directly through Agoura’s 91301 ZIP, and that single event rewrote how gate repair works here in ways that don’t apply to neighboring Calabasas or DoorKing in Thousand Oaks flatlands. Nearly every post-fire gate replacement in Agoura now falls under LA County’s Very High Fire Hazard Severity Zone requirements — non-combustible hardware, specific setback rules from structures, and fire-resistant material choices are mandatory, not optional.
For DoorKing owners, this means our retrofits here always include Knox-compatible key switches and battery backup systems, because LA County fire codes require emergency access that doesn’t depend on grid power. We’ve had Agoura homeowners call us after another company installed a standard DoorKing 6200 operator without the Knox switch, only to fail their final inspection and have to tear the operator housing open again. That’s wasted money and a gate that sits unfinished for weeks. We do it once, to code, with the fire-specific hardware already integrated.

Post-fire damage usually shows as melted or heat-warped control housings, seized gearboxes from debris infiltration, and footing displacement from firefighting water saturation. Expansive clay soil in Agoura swells with winter rain and contracts in summer, shifting post footings that your 6200 operator’s travel limits were calibrated to. New concrete from post-Woolsey rebuilds settles for several years, making this worse. We relevel footings and recalibrate limits to actual gate position, not the original pour.
